Crispy, seasoned chicken with a juicy interior, a staple of Atlanta and the broader Southern table. It is one of the city’s most iconic comfort foods.
A classic sweet-savory Southern pairing of fried chicken served with waffles, often with syrup or hot sauce. It is strongly associated with Atlanta brunch culture.
Creamy stone-ground grits topped with shrimp, often with gravy, bacon, or spice. This beloved Southern dish is widely found on Atlanta menus.

Atlanta is moderate for U.S. city travel. Budget eats are easy to find, but hotels, car costs, and upscale dining can raise daily spending.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, taxis/rideshares 10-15%, hotel staff USD 2-5, and round up for cafes if desired.
